Specs per Rockford Fosgate:

POWER RATINGS:

-4 Ohms - 22.5 watts per channel continuous power, both channels driven into 4 Ohms from 20-20,000Hz with less than 0.05% THD

-4 Ohms - 40 watts per channel continuous power, both channels driven into 4 Ohms at 1000Hz with less than 10% THD

-2 Ohms - 35 watts per channel continuous power, both channels driven into 2 Ohms from 20-20,000Hz with less than 0.1% THD

Frequency Response - 20-20,000 Hz +/- 1dB

Bandwidth - 15 - 100,000 Hz +/- 3dB

Damping Factor:

At Circuit Board - over 200 (at 4 Ohms)

At Speaker Lead - over 50 (at 4 Ohms)

Signal to Noise Ratio - Over 80dB unweighted

EQUALIZATION:

Bass Boost: 0 to +18dB maximum at 45Hz

Treble Boost: 0 to +12dB maximum at 20,000Hz

PROTECTION:

The Punch 45HD Mosfet is protected by two 3-Amp speaker inline fuses and by a 15-Amp battery fuse. A thermal switch shuts down the amplifier in case of overheating. Internal circuitry limits power in case of overload.

DIMENSIONS:

6.6" Long x 8.6" Wide x 2.2" High
